Live from Basel’s popular AVO SESSION festival (now known as Baloise Session) on October 22, 2011, Portland, Oregon’s “little orchestra“ Pink Martini plays their original instrumental showpiece, “The Flying Squirrel“, written by bandleader Thomas M. Lauderdale and Pink Martini trombonist Robert Taylor. Not featured on any studio album, the song is a highlight of the band’s live shows, where it features several of the band’s talented instrumentalists in solos. Featuring Jeffrey Budin on trombone, Gavin Bondy on trumpet, Dan Faehnle on guitar, Phil Baker on bass, and Brian Davis on drums. This performance is a special delight, with lead singer Storm Large heading into the audience to dance with the fans.
